Comprehending the Mechanics of Bifold Closet Doors

Before we dive into the repair procedure, it's important to understand the mechanics of bifold closet doors. These doors consist of two panels linked by hinges, which fold together when the door is closed. The doors are normally mounted on a track system, permitting them to move smoothly along the top of the door frame. Comprehending the door's mechanics will help you determine the origin of the problem and make the required repairs.

Step-by-Step Repair Guide

1. Stuck Doors

If your bifold closet doors are stuck, follow these steps:
Remove any particles or dust from the tracks and hinges.Use some lube, such as silicone spray or oil, to the hinges and tracks.Inspect the door alignment and change the hinges if required.If the doors are still stuck, attempt removing the doors from the tracks and examining the track system for any damage.
2. Misaligned Doors

If your bifold closet doors are misaligned, follow these actions:
Check the door frame for any warping or damage.Adjust the hinges to ensure they're aligned effectively.Utilize a level to ensure the doors are effectively aligned.If the doors are still misaligned, attempt getting rid of the doors from the tracks and reattaching them.
3. Faulty Hinges

If your bifold closet doors have defective hinges, follow these actions:
Remove the doors from the tracks.Check the hinges for any damage or wear.Replace the faulty hinges with new ones.Reattach the doors to the tracks.
4. Harmed Tracks

If your bifold closet doors have actually damaged tracks, follow these actions:
Remove the doors from the tracks.Examine the tracks for any damage or wear.Replace the harmed tracks with new ones.Reattach the doors to the tracks.
FAQs

Q: How do I prevent bifold closet doors from becoming stuck?

A: To prevent bifold closet doors from becoming stuck, regularly tidy the tracks and hinges, and use lube as required.

Q: Can I replace bifold closet doors with regular doors?

A: Yes, it's possible to replace bifold closet doors with regular doors, but it may require modifications to the door frame and surrounding location.

Q: How do I change bifold closet doors to fit appropriately?

A: To adjust bifold closet doors to fit correctly, inspect the door positioning and change the hinges as needed. Utilize a level to make sure the doors are effectively aligned.
